针对位于东海外缘台湾东北部冲绳海槽张裂带以西的深海海域声速场的统计资料,分析利用少于5号经验正交函数描述声速场,探索利用经验正交函数、海表和温跃层水温对海水声速剖面进行预报的方法.研究结果对于声速场数据库的建设、海洋声速场的预报和水下声层析技术具有重要的意义.
